Output f8999ba00ca00490b06c2b2d17cf709022d3db85b74274fdaaf508ef1e860217:71

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95e5a71c3f455c504ab743aaa3105d198c007cbe5ec469d2ca07959a72855605
address
bc1pjhj6w8plg4w9qj4hgw42xyzarxxqql97tmzxn5k2q72e5u592czs5t7r3z
transaction
f8999ba00ca00490b06c2b2d17cf709022d3db85b74274fdaaf508ef1e860217
confirmations
26381
spent
true